Lime (material)
Lime
is a
calcium
-containing
inorganic
material in which
carbonates
,
oxides
and
hydroxides
predominate. Strictly speaking, lime is
calcium oxide
or
calcium hydroxide
. It is also the name of the natural
mineral
(native lime) CaO which occurs as a product of
coal seam fires
and in altered
limestone
xenoliths
in
volcanic
ejecta. The word "lime" originates with its earliest use as building mortar and has the sense of "sticking or adhering."
